Hi Petra,

Welcome to on-call for the Lanternfold reporting stack. The most common page you'll get involves timezone handling in report exports. Scheduled exports render timestamps in the workspace's configured zone, but the legacy CSV path still assumes UTC, so customers in offset zones sometimes see rows shifted across day boundaries. If a ticket comes in, first check whether the export used the legacy path — the job metadata shows it. The full triage flowchart, known affected accounts, and the remediation script are on this internal page.

dashboard of tawef-hagug = https://superset.norvadyn.local/display/projects/build/ticket/build/spaces/ticket/1e989f0e6c200d20fc4ae06b

New joiners: the planner runs every morning at 06:30 and produces a route sheet per region. Inputs are machine inventory snapshots and the demand model's weekly forecast. If a run fails, check the ingest table first — stale snapshots are the usual cause. Never rerun mid-morning without clearing the lock row, or drivers get duplicate routes. Escalate to the planning channel if two consecutive runs fail. To inspect inventory snapshots and lock state directly, connect to the planner database with the string below.

database URL for haduf-tajof: redis://holox_svc:c9@db-3fb6.lumicworks.local:5432/fraeth

### Account Recovery — Perioda Timetable Solver

If the solver admin account at Hollowbrook Academy is locked, verify the lockout in the Perioda console, then initiate recovery from the on-call workstation. Confirm the solver queue is paused first so no timetable runs are mid-flight. When prompted by the recovery wizard, enter the passphrase shown below.

vault phrase of tajef-tafog = istox-sorax-zorox-casok-holox-kelix-weneth-drueth-casion

**Key ceremony checklist — item 7: Stridemark chip reader**

Before sealing the ceremony envelope, verify the Stridemark timing-chip reader at the Bellarive finish line accepts the new signing key. Power-cycle the reader, confirm the firmware handshake, and log the result. To complete re-enrollment, the reader's maintenance console requires the recovery passphrase, noted on the following line.

vault phrase of hahip-kafog = druix-quenmir-jorox